Bits

Name

Description

31:5

reserved

6

TXFIFO_WR_

REQ

Transmit FIFO Write Request

0 –

No Request for data write to MMC_TXFIFO FIFO

1 –

Request for data write to MMC_TXFIFO FIFO

Cleared after each write but immediately set again unless there are no entries left in the
FIFIO.

5

RXFIFO_RD_

REQ

Receive FIFO Read Request

0 –

No Request for data read from MMC_RXFIFO FIFO

1 –

Request for data read from MMC_RXFIFO FIFO

Cleared after each read but immediately set again unless the FIFO is empty.

4

CLK_IS_

OFF

Clock Is Off

0 –

MMC clock has not been turned off

1 –

MMC clock has been turned off, due to stop bit in STRP_CLK register

Cleared by the MMC_STAT[CLK_EN] bit when the clock is started.

3

STOP_CMD

For stream mode writes.

0 –

MMC is not ready for the stop transmission command

1 –

MMC is ready for the stop transmission command

Cleared when CMD12 is loaded in the MMC_CMD register and the clock is started.

2

END_CMD_R

ES

End Command Response

0 –

MMC has not received the response

1 –

MMC has received the response or a response time-out has occurred

Cleared by the MMC_STAT[END_CMD_RES] bit.

1

PRG_DONE

Programming Done

0 –

Card has not finished programming and is busy

1 –

Card has finished programming and is no longer busy

Cleared by the MMC_STAT[PRG_DONE] bit.

0

DATA_TRAN_

DONE

Data Transfer Done

0 –

Data transfer is not complete

1 –

Data transfer has completed or a read data time-out has occurred

Cleared by the MMC_STAT[DATA_TRAN_DONE] bit.
